Type
ORACLE
Validation date
2024-08-01 09:47: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01897,
    "usd": 0.02046
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00011B0002EE0CCC23BFF959879063DE978C1DD086FE6504DED5F09CF80B415F6C7A

Previous signature

E8A119206E18C64D62755C8593B859B9CE622988014115D6056AA25EF6E9026C033CBC7BD6C832DCB4E7D3E5C26D18510CCD0ED6FB625EBCA69C2F7C991EC001

Origin signature

3044022012CEF9A4B580D6B744A4450390F15AD516AC651289EEE8D905C3F4D1D8773BC602205453B818D79377808D5D31412B85A8BBFE5B975FB0EC5E292B4F3C4883514E25

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

00A82C1F4D29E0A5909BFA9A6E0903A5B358CA6073C93314C3A2CBED92E994D8ED

Coordinator signature

F8162EDE9F03D4BCDA016BEA0ABEEC28D379326BDEBD360B39BD56DBE78A136785553234E8B9F68415D0BFB6D5F375F6D6AC497F36B61C33242ADB0FA7A45603

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

84B7969BE8A9AF8A93B77D5F4CE2BF41E5717AC14BC24C8616A6B2A6E14389BE0064C5ED6AA31AFDF7E7504E2ED76C45C3A56288154A06B349478C958FE89E05

Validator #2 public key

00010F2A0E4C424582A94BD90E05FE6931628F91988ABBE387D365994F1F3FCF5A12

Validator #2 signature

7E3297A7DD8EC8CFE58EC3042F19A11DD965082B0354F971BC432ABD71EF39248B7D6E520FF88AA61C0F9FC40C49A8C27EF3AB2746200A6EF4005F5A4F961B07